Definitions:

Lateral Meristems

Plant tissue responsible for growth in thickness or girth in a maturing plant, found in the cambium and producing cells that differentiate into various tissues.

Leaf Primordia

Embryonic tissues at the tips of plant shoots that develop into leaves.

Meristematic Cells

Undifferentiated cells in plants that are capable of division and contribute to plant growth, found in regions like the tips of roots and shoots.

Root Cap

A covering of cells over the root tip that protects the delicate meristematic tissue directly behind it.
